  • Key Responsibilities
  • • Assist in the development, implementation, reporting and evolution of ESG strategy in-house.
  • • Assist in the development, implementation, reporting and evolution of ESG strategies for Clients.
  • • Facilitate the development, benchmarking, implementation and ongoing review of appropriate sustainability objectives, targets and improvement programmes for assets/funds/portfolios.
  • • Monitor and report on fund/portfolio sustainability performance and progress against sustainability objectives.
  • • Lead regular catch-up calls/meetings with allocated Clients. Routinely prepare and present at Client meetings to increase sustainability awareness and engagement.
  • • Provide support and technical advice to all stakeholders to enable them to undertake their roles and responsibilities for sustainability.
  • • Innovate and lead initiatives to engage and educate PM/PMFM employees, contractors, and tenants/occupiers to increase data coverage, improve data quality, and improve sustainability performance for assets/funds/portfolios.
  • • Respond to requests for information regarding existing ESG strategy performance from rating and reporting agencies, current or prospective investors and other stakeholders.
  • • Work with PMFM Compliance Team to monitor changes in legislation and best practice to ensure continuing legal compliance and best practice in the UK.
  • • Provide ESG advice as needed.
  • Person Specification/Requirements
  • • Master’s degree in a relevant field (e.g. Sustainability, Environmental/Earth Sciences, Responsible Business) OR comparable experience built up over your career
  • • Professional experience working as an ESG programme manager, sustainability consultant, or similar within the Commercial Real Estate/Built Environment sector
  • • Exceptional written and oral communication skills: articulate, assertive and confident
  • • Ability to engage and educate a diverse set of stakeholder groups including fund managers, property managers and building managers
  • • Detail-oriented: Strong sense of commitment, a willingness to learn more and a desire to work in a dynamic, deadline-driven team environment
  • • Proficiency in English
  • • Proficiency in Salesforce, MS Office and Google Applications
  • • Experience in a range of reporting tools and platforms, e.g. MS Power BI and Tableau
  • • Experience and willingness to present at conferences and forums
  • • Experience in ISO standards (14001, 50001), BREEAM (In Use), LCC, and ESG reporting frameworks including GRESB, INREV, and EPRA would be an advantage.
